    The zoo was created by Henry and Joan Lupa, who emigrated from Poland in the 1960s. They purchased a farm in Ludlow, and housed a small collection of animals. Originally, Henry Lupa started a landscaping company and then a construction company, but eventually decided to open a zoo, as local families would often come visit the animals on their farm.

    Lusitano Stadium, located in Ludlow, Massachusetts, is a 3,000-seat stadium built in 1918 currently used for soccer.Currently its tenants are the Western Mass Pioneers of the USL League Two, the New England Mutiny of United Women's Soccer and the Western United Pioneers premier youth club

    The Ludlow Village Historic District encompasses part of a historic mill village, and the economic center of the town of Ludlow, Massachusetts beginning in the later years of the 19th century. [2] The area started to take over from Ludlow Center as the center of economic importance with the arrival of jute mills on the Chicopee River . [ 3 ]

    Western Mass Pioneers is an American soccer team based in Ludlow, Massachusetts, United States. Founded in 1998, the team plays in USL League Two, the fourth tier of the American soccer pyramid. The team plays its home games at Lusitano Stadium, where they have played since 1998. The team's colors are red, black and white.

    Gremio Lusitano is an amateur soccer team from Ludlow, Massachusetts.. Founded in 1922 in a garage on Franklin Street, [1] the team had competed for several seasons during the 1930s in the New England Division of the American Soccer League, [2] but for most of its existence it has been an amateur or semi-professional club.

    The Ludlow Clock Tower is a clock tower located in Ludlow, Massachusetts.The tower is part of the Ludlow Mills complex, and is depicted as part of the town seal. [1] The tower was constructed as part of the complex in 1886 by the Ludlow Manufacturing and Sales Company.
